The Hess test or Rumpel-Leede test is a medical test used to assess capillary fragility. [1] It is also called the Tourniquet test . To perform the test, pressure is applied to the forearm with a blood pressure cuff inflated to between systolic and diastolic blood pressure for 10 minutes.

The tourniquet test, which is particularly useful in settings where no laboratory investigations are readily available, involves the application of a blood pressure cuff at between the diastolic and systolic pressure for five minutes, followed by the counting of any petechial hemorrhages; a higher number makes a diagnosis of dengue more likely.
